1. What was William Paterson's main contribution to the Constitutional Convention?
tankabanditka [31]

The main contribution of William Paterson  was to protect the rights as well as look after  the small states.

Explanation:

William Paterson was the person who started the New Jersey Plan. His main aim was to help the small states to protect their rights. According to this plan in the Congress each state must be having equal representative. He was not ready to accept the proportional representation because he always feared that the small states will be ignored their interest will not be given any priority.

As his proposal was not accepted so he made decision to leave the convention in the end of July but later returned in September when his proposal was accepted and he signed the constitution.
